Online versus offline differences in meta-analysis data collection must be considered. Internet-based research can collect large data sets from a diverse world population. Therefore, it is necessary to describe the sample of participants in detail to verify whether this potential of Internet-based research is used and how.
Relevant sample information, therefore, includes which country and in which languages the study was carried out, the age of the participants, and whether only university students were considered to assess the heterogeneity and generalizability of the results (Kaufman, 2024).
Like meta-analyses on traditional studies, for meta-analyses on Internet-based research for study aggregation, it is necessary to collect the number of participants and effect sizes for the output variables of interest. Especially for Internet-based surveys, the number of participants who dropped out is a valuable effect size to consider in meta-analyses.
Ideally, the coding procedure is conducted by a team of experts in the research area who will meta-analyse and agree on the different codes. At least two coders are required for any subsequent calculation of intercoder reliability values.
Freelon's (2010, 2013) ReCal software is ideal for intercoder reliability estimation and provides a data set quality value for subsequent analysis*. ReCal comprises three separate modules, each designed to handle specific types of data, whether nominal, ordinal, or interval/ratio-level. and is based on an online survey requesting study coding sent to the first authors. This strategy saves time and increases reliability in future meta-analyses. Additionally, Kaufmann & Reips (2024) provide a survey model for meta-analyses (Univ. Konstanz)**.
Text mining is a valuable support tool in the coding procedure of systematic reviews, as it can potentially increase the objectivity of the review process.
Before performing any data aggregation analysis, a data description must be provided first, typically summarized in a table.
